Get in TouchThe Nissan repair market in the immediate Mount Nebo area is limited due to its rural nature. Residents typically travel to neighboring commercial centers for specialized automotive services. The overall market quality is bifurcated: you have skilled independent shops in towns like Summersville and Sutton that offer personalized service and competitive pricing for most Nissan repairs, and you have the factory-authorized dealership in Bridgeport for top-tier, brand-specific needs. **Competition Level:** Moderate. While there are several general repair shops, true specialists with deep Nissan expertise, particularly for performance models (GT-R) or hybrid systems, are scarce. The independents compete on price, customer service, and convenience, while the dealership holds a monopoly on factory-certified services.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are generally lower than the national average, reflecting West Virginia's cost of living. Independent shops like Summersville Imports may charge $95 - $115/hour, while the dealership (White Nissan) will be higher, typically in the $125 - $145/hour range. Parts costs will also be higher at the dealership due to the use of genuine Nissan components. For major services like a CVT transmission replacement, expect quotes from $3,500 to $5,500+ depending on the model and service provider.

Given our hilly terrain and seasonal weather, common repairs include CVT transmission service or issues, brake system wear from frequent stopping on inclines, and suspension components like struts. Winter road treatments also make undercarriage rust and exhaust system repairs more frequent for local Nissans.
Look for a local shop with certified technicians, especially those with Nissan-specific training (ASE certification is a strong indicator). Check reviews from other Nicholas County residents and ask if they use original equipment manufacturer (OEM) or high-quality aftermarket parts to ensure durability on our local roads.
Repair costs are more dependent on the specific model and repair than the brand itself. However, some Nissan models with specialized CVT transmissions may have higher service costs. Always request a detailed written estimate from your local shop before authorizing work to avoid surprises.
For most rout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and common repairs, a qualified local Mount Nebo shop can provide excellent service and save you travel time. For very complex computer issues, major warranty work, or specific recall repairs that require proprietary dealership tools, a dealership trip may be necessary.
Definitely mention your regular driving on steep, winding routes like those along the Gauley River or Route 19, as this stresses brakes, transmissions, and suspension. Also, inform them if the vehicle is used on unpaved roads common in the area, as this can accelerate wear on components like shocks and tie rods.
